The onion story is quite accurate. Most of Britain's onions were grown in the Channel Islands (Jersey, Guernsey, Aldernay and the like), so the supply was abruptly cut off after the Nazis took over the islands in 1940.

In the years ahead they started growing them in Britain, but even so the supply remained unequal to the demand.
